我叫程禹涵,一名苏州大学的准大一男生,统计学专业,喜欢打篮球,初学吉他一个月。这是我第一次写博客,也是第一次将我的思想、我的收获分享给所有与我有缘的人,激动,也很忐忑。
其实我一开始并不知道自己会上统计学,也不知道自己未来是否会用得上计算机,学C语言只是觉得多门技术多条路。我现阶段学C语言的目标其实就是打好基础,每天起码半小时的练习时间,希望在假期结束时能初步掌控C语言,为大学打下坚实基础。我最想进入到互联网大厂是百度,因为我毕竟是统计专业,百度可以给我一个更有利的发展空间。我也知道,这个目标不是简单的学C语言就可以办到的,但我会为此而不懈努力。
说这么多自己的规划,其实还是因为我自认为不是一个有恒心的人。我在分享的同时也是希望会以此激励自己,以广大博友监督自己。
第一次用电脑记笔记
- 头文件#incloud<stdio.h>
- main函数 主函数 (程序入口)
程序都是main开始运行
写法:int main()
……
return 0
注意:1.有且只有一个
2. 一个项目中即使有多个”.c“文件, 也只能有一个主函数
- 符号只能用英文符号
- printf(print format)(库函数)
在屏幕上打印信息
- \n换行
%d打印整型
%c打印字符(依据ACCLL码值)
%s打印字符串
- 关键字(C语言保留的名字符号)
(程序员自己创建标识符的时候不能和关键字重复)
- 字符和ASCLL编码
(C语言中字符使用单括号''圈起来的)
ASCLL编码就是把键盘上的富含都用代码表示
A-Z码值从65-90
a-z码值从97-122
码值1-31无法打印
- 双引号"abc"引入字符串
打印格式用%s
printf("%s","hehe");
或用双引号
printf("hehe\n")
- 定义一个char型数组
char arr1[]="abc"
或char arr2[]={'a','b','c'\0}
\0是字符串结束标志
char arr2如果没有\0会出现乱码
- \0 \n 都是转义字符
即转变了意思的字符
还有\?
在问号连用时使用,防止被解析为三字母词
- \还可以转译符号
如想打印‘ 可以printf("%s","\'")
- 如果已有转义字符
如打印\test,而\t已是转义字符
可以再加一个斜杠 printf("%s","\\test)